Frankfort - David A. Marlow Sr., 70, died Thursday, December 24, 2009 at the Mary Imogene Bassett Hospital in Cooperstown following a battle with cancer.
Born in Malone NY on 9/10/39, He was the son of the late Allen & Gertrude Marlow. He attended schools in Malone, NY. In 1959 he married Ruth Barrington which ended in divorce. On 10/16/69 he married Betty (Horning) Richards. She passed away on 6/25/78 after nearly 10 years of marriage. He then married Grace Kane on 11/27/79 which ended in divorce in 1988
He was employed as a Machinist for at Chicago Pneumatic, Bendix and later Lucas Aerospace all in Utica until retirement in 1990. He was also Assistant Fire Chief of the Frankfort Center Volunteer Fire Department.
He enjoyed hunting, fishing and bowling and spending time with his family.
He is survived by one son, David Jr. & companion (Brenda Youker) of Ilion, NY., Stepchildren, Ronald Richards, Darlene (& Jerry Bowling) of South Carolina, Barbara (& Gary Zolacha) of Utica, NY, and Duain Richards & companion (Georgia Rando) of Mohawk NY.
He is also survived by two brothers, Gordon & Geraldine Marlowe & Earl & Carolyn Marlow, both from Malone, NY., four sisters and a brother-in law, Margaret Abare & Anita Payne of Malone, Theresa Wells of Herkimer & Elizabeth & James Savage of Fulton.
He was predeceased by four brothers, Gilbert,George, Edward & Ronald and four Sisters, Lydia Belair, Harriet Dufrane, Nellie Duquette, Josephine Dufrane
